On June 2nd 2008, Buckley ran a 4-pane comic strip titled "Loss." In it, Ethan rushes into a hospital and discovers that his girlfriend, Lilah, has had a miscarriage. Therefore was born Just about the most legendary imageries in Online meme heritage.
While It is really unclear when and the place this began, it possible started all-around 2014. A 4chan publish dated March fifteenth, 2014, commenting around the deconstruction with the comic was itself became a Loss edit (revealed beneath).
A minimalist Variation on the meme will involve the sequence in the exact same 4-panel style; initial panel with a single vertical line, next panel with two vertical strains, the next line slightly shorter, third panel with two equal vertical traces, along with the fourth panel with a vertical line and also a horizontal line. A reaction to recognizing the meme was "Is this Loss?" loss comic The meme saw a resurgence all over 2017.

On June 2nd, 2008, Buckley posted a comic strip titled "Loss" in which the female lead Lilah suffered a miscarriage. The strip marked an important improve in tone with the normally comedic comic plus the inadequately executed drama with the comic spurred Ctrl+Alt+Del's sizeable anti-fandom to mockery.
